For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 389 students in Cohasset School District.
Public Preschools in Cohasset School District have a diversity score of 0.17, which is less than the Massachusetts public preschool average of 0.68.
Minority enrollment is 9%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Massachusetts public preschool average of 53% (majority Hispanic).

Cohasset School District, which is ranked within the top 10% of all 393 school districts in Massachusetts (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2022-2023 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 95% has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

The revenue/student of $24,432 is higher than the state median of $23,854. The school district revenue/student has grown by 12%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$23,654 is less than the state median of $24,611. The school district spending/student has grown by 11% over four school years.
